Subject: Re: [PATCH 3/5] xfs: recover dquot buffers unconditionally
Date: Tue, 19 Mar 2024 11:49:58 -0700 [thread overview]
Message-ID: <20240319184958.GD1927156@frogsfrogsfrogs> (raw)
In-Reply-To: <20240319021547.3483050-4-david@fromorbit.com>
On Tue, Mar 19, 2024 at 01:15:22PM +1100, Dave Chinner wrote:
> From: Dave Chinner <dchinner@redhat.com>
>
> Dquot buffers are only logged when the dquot cluster is allocated.
> Recovery of them is always done and not conditional on an LSN found
> in the buffer because there aren't dquots stamped in the buffer when
> the initialisation is replayed after allocation.
>
> Signed-off-by: Dave Chinner <dchinner@redhat.com>
Looks sane,
Reviewed-by: Darrick J. Wong <djwong@kernel.org>

> +/*
> + * Do a sanity check of each region in the item to ensure we are actually
> + * recovering a dquot buffer item.
> + */
> +static int
> +xlog_recover_verify_dquot_buf_item(
> + struct xfs_mount *mp,
> + struct xlog_recover_item *item,
> + struct xfs_buf *bp,
> + struct xfs_buf_log_format *buf_f)
> +{
> + xfs_failaddr_t fa;
> + int i;
> +
> + switch (xfs_blft_from_flags(buf_f)) {
> + case XFS_BLFT_UDQUOT_BUF:
> + case XFS_BLFT_PDQUOT_BUF:
> + case XFS_BLFT_GDQUOT_BUF:
> + break;
> + default:
> + xfs_alert(mp,
> + "XFS: dquot buffer log format type mismatch in %s.",
> + __func__);
> + xfs_buf_corruption_error(bp, __this_address);
> + return -EFSCORRUPTED;
> + }
> +
> + for (i = 1; i < item->ri_total; i++) {
> + if (item->ri_buf[i].i_addr == NULL) {
> + xfs_alert(mp,
> + "XFS: NULL dquot in %s.", __func__);
> + return -EFSCORRUPTED;
> + }
> + if (item->ri_buf[i].i_len < sizeof(struct xfs_disk_dquot)) {
> + xfs_alert(mp,
> + "XFS: dquot too small (%d) in %s.",
> + item->ri_buf[i].i_len, __func__);
> + return -EFSCORRUPTED;
> + }
> + fa = xfs_dquot_verify(mp, item->ri_buf[i].i_addr, -1);
> + if (fa) {
> + xfs_alert(mp,
> +"dquot corrupt at %pS trying to replay into block 0x%llx",
> + fa, xfs_buf_daddr(bp));
> + return -EFSCORRUPTED;
> + }
> + }
> + return 0;
> +}
